android - 我的应用程序需要显示在共享选项列表中

标签 android

<分区>

当用户在任何推特应用程序中单击共享选项时,我需要什么才能让我的应用程序显示在列表中。 例如,使用官方推特应用程序,如果用户单击分享推文选项,我希望显示我的应用程序,以便他们可以与我的应用程序共享。 谢谢。

最佳答案

您需要向您的 list 文件添加一个 Intent 过滤器,以将您的应用注册为能够处理共享操作 Intent :

<activity android:name=".YourAwesomeActivity">
<intent-filter
    android:label="Lorem ipsum">
    <action android:name="android.intent.action.SEND" />
    <category android:name="android.intent.category.DEFAULT" />
    <data android:mimeType="text/plain" />
</intent-filter>
</activity>

关于android - 我的应用程序需要显示在共享选项列表中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29870501/

相关文章:

两个应用程序之间的android通信

android - Kotlin 协同程序 - 如果一段时间后第一个任务没有完成,则开始另一个任务

java - 在Android中只创建一个类的一个实例

android - AndEngine 和 Box2D 中的 Spring 墙

android - 无法解析配置 ':app:_debugCompile' 的所有依赖项。在安卓工作室

android - 使用 PagingDataAdapter 时如何恢复 recyclerview 滚动位置?

android - 使用 AndEngine 播放动画

android - 通过 gradle 添加 fmod

android - flutter 构建 apk : Build failed with an exception (annotations 26. 1.0)

android - Cordova jQuery AJAX 调用在 30 秒后超时,无论超时设置如何